Transaction 4e36886f42521699e646dcc27976382405fa7eda97df547c2fe0e062a26fcbe1
1 Input
1 Output
-
4e36886f42521699e646dcc27976382405fa7eda97df547c2fe0e062a26fcbe1:0
- value
- 64994450
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f72c54eeb99a18e8eb30e04cde0e0304c799b027 OP_EQUAL
- address
- 3QDww9iVyPYHA3YQ5ENsud5Px9ekLtK9yR